Which Dance Traditionally Begins And Ends The Show At The Moulin Rouge In Paris?

The iconic Moulin Rouge in Paris is famous for its extravagant cabaret shows that feature a variety of dance performances. One of the most well-known and traditional dances that opens and closes the show at the Moulin Rouge is the can-can dance.

The can-can dance originated in the 19th century and quickly became popular in Parisian cabarets and dance halls. Known for its high-energy kicks, jumps, and provocative movements, the can-can has become synonymous with the Moulin Rouge and its lively performances.

At the beginning of the show, the can-can dancers take the stage in their vibrant costumes, kicking their legs high in the air and twirling with precision. The fast-paced music and synchronized movements of the dancers create an electrifying atmosphere that sets the tone for the rest of the performance.

As the show nears its end, the can-can dancers return to the stage for a grand finale. The energy and excitement reach a peak as the dancers showcase their skills and entertain the audience with their dynamic performance.
